### 1. Hiking Trails and Nature Walks

One of the most popular outdoor attractions in Pennsylvania is its extensive network of hiking trails. With over 1,500 miles of trails in the Appalachian Trail system alone, hikers can immerse themselves in the natural beauty of the state. The Laurel Highlands region, home to Ohiopyle State Park, offers stunning views, waterfalls, and diverse wildlife. The park features trails for all skill levels, from leisurely walks to challenging hikes that lead to the breathtaking Cucumber Falls.

### 2. Scenic State Parks

Pennsylvania is home to 121 state parks, each offering unique outdoor attractions. Ricketts Glen State Park, famous for its 22 named waterfalls, is a must-visit for nature enthusiasts. The park's Falls Trail is a challenging yet rewarding hike that takes you past some of the most stunning waterfalls in the state. Another gem is Presque Isle State Park, where visitors can enjoy sandy beaches, swimming, and birdwatching along the shores of Lake Erie.

### 3. Camping and RVing

For those who want to fully immerse themselves in Pennsylvania's natural beauty, camping is an excellent option. The state offers numerous campgrounds, ranging from primitive sites to fully equipped RV parks. Cook Forest State Park is a favorite among campers, featuring towering old-growth trees and the picturesque Clarion River. Whether you prefer tent camping under the stars or a cozy RV experience, Pennsylvania's camping sites provide the perfect backdrop for a memorable outdoor getaway.

### 4. Water Sports and Fishing

With its many lakes, rivers, and streams, Pennsylvania is a haven for water sports enthusiasts. The Susquehanna River, one of the longest rivers in the United States, offers excellent opportunities for kayaking, canoeing, and fishing. Anglers can find a variety of fish species, including bass, trout, and catfish. Additionally, Lake Wallenpaupack is a popular destination for boating, jet skiing, and fishing, making it one of the top outdoor attractions in Pennsylvania.

### 5. Wildlife Watching

Pennsylvania's diverse ecosystems provide a habitat for a wide range of wildlife, making it an ideal location for wildlife watching. The state's numerous wildlife refuges and parks, such as the John Heinz National Wildlife Refuge at Tinicum, offer opportunities to observe migratory birds and other animals in their natural habitats. Bring your binoculars and camera to capture stunning photos of Pennsylvania's rich biodiversity.

### 6. Winter Activities

When winter arrives, Pennsylvania transforms into a winter wonderland, offering a variety of outdoor attractions for snow lovers. Ski resorts such as Seven Springs and Blue Mountain provide skiing, snowboarding, and tubing for thrill-seekers. For those who prefer a quieter experience, snowshoeing and cross-country skiing trails are abundant in the state's parks, allowing you to enjoy the serene beauty of the snow-covered landscape.
